... Flash Flood Watch in effect from noon EDT today through this evening...
The National Weather Service in Blacksburg has issued a
* Flash Flood Watch for portions of northwest North Carolina... Virginia and southeast West Virginia... including the following areas... in northwest North Carolina... Alleghany NC... Ashe and Watauga. In Virginia... Alleghany VA... Bath... Bland... Botetourt... Carroll... Craig... Floyd... Giles... Grayson... Montgomery... Pulaski... Roanoke... Rockbridge... Smyth... Tazewell and Wythe. In southeast West Virginia... Greenbrier... Mercer... Monroe and Summers.
* From noon EDT today through this evening
* slow moving thunderstorms capable of producing very heavy rain are possible this afternoon and evening. The ground was already saturated from rainfall during the past few days. Any additional heavy rain may cause flash flooding... especially if the rain falls in just an hour or two.
* Heavy rain may cause streams and creeks to quickly rise out of their banks. Low water crossings and any poor drainage areas may also flood due to heavy rain.
Precautionary/preparedness actions...
A Flash Flood Watch means that conditions may develop that lead to flash flooding. Flash flooding is a very dangerous situation. You should monitor later forecasts and be prepared to take action should flash flood warnings be issued.
